Only One King

30 Sept 2019

I give no loyalty to royalties of any earthly nation
No man made queen or man made king can be all knowing of everything

God gave us the only King His Son the Christ of whom we sing
He came was born lived taught and by man was torn
Then crusified the sacrifice for sin and from the tomb He rose again

Now sin is conquered for those who accept Him
One death and then no death ever again
